The Senior Center Adult Transportation (SCAT) program is a versatile non-emergency medical transportation option catering to the needs of older adults. Offering convenient transportation via taxi, bus, train, and even on-demand rideshare services, SCAT ensures that older adults can easily access essential services and appointments. Riders have the flexibility to schedule their transportation in advance, ranging from a day to a week, to suit their needs.
SCAT accommodates various payment methods, including insurance, vouchers, donations, and credit cards, making it convenient for older adults to pay for their rides. With affordable pricing at $2.50 one way, and even lower rates for those with a Senior SmarTrip card, SCAT aims to make transportation accessible to all. The program also offers paratransit services, assisting riders with bags and parcels, and allowing service animals to accompany passengers during their journey.
Furthermore, SCAT provides a range of additional services such as door-to-door transportation, a driver willing to wait for passengers during errands or appointments, and shared rides for a more social transportation experience.
